😐Monthly costs for one person with rent: $2,359 in Barcelona versus $1,957 in Hjorring.
😐Estimated couple costs with rent: $3,498 in Barcelona versus $3,079 in Hjorring.
😐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$4,638 in Barcelona versus $4,201 in Hjorring.
🌍Living in Barcelona is roughly 21% more expensive than in Hjorring, driven mainly by Getting Around.
📊Both cities are pricier than the global median: Barcelona77% above, Hjorring47% above.

Barcelona vs Hjorring: Cost of Living - Frequently Asked Questions
What is the total cost difference between living in Barcelona and in Hjorring?
Barcelona and Hjorring differ by about 21% in total monthly costs ($2,359 vs $1,957 including rent). Hjorring is meaningfully more affordable – a gap that matters a lot on a fixed or modest income.
What salary covers living expenses in Barcelona compared to Hjorring?
You'd need roughly $3,539 in Barcelona and $2,935 in Hjorring to live well. The gap comes down to housing and overall price levels. Both cities are liveable on less, but these numbers represent actual comfort.
How do apartment prices compare in Barcelona and in Hjorring?
Rent for a central apartment: $1,524 in Barcelona versus $918 in Hjorring. Housing is usually the single largest factor when comparing overall living costs between the two.
What is the difference in childcare costs between Barcelona and Hjorring?
Childcare runs $725 in Barcelona versus $532 in Hjorring. Over years of preschool, even a modest monthly gap compounds into a major financial factor for families.
Which city has cheaper grocery shopping?
Shoppers in Barcelona pay roughly 14% less for everyday groceries. It's an unusual reversal that partly offsets higher costs elsewhere.
